当前位置:首页 / EXCEL

Excel如何排序数据?排序技巧有哪些?

作者:佚名|分类:EXCEL|浏览:101|发布时间:2025-03-12 01:26:25

Excel如何排序数据?排序技巧有哪些?

在Excel中,排序数据是一项基本且常用的操作,它可以帮助我们快速地整理和分析数据。无论是进行简单的数据整理,还是进行复杂的数据分析,掌握Excel的排序功能都是必不可少的。以下,我们将详细介绍如何在Excel中排序数据,并分享一些实用的排序技巧。

一、Excel排序的基本操作

1. 打开Excel,选中需要排序的数据区域。

2. 点击“数据”选项卡,在“排序和筛选”组中,点击“排序”。

3. 在弹出的“排序”对话框中,设置排序依据、排序方式(升序或降序)和排序数据区域。

4. 点击“确定”,即可完成排序操作。

二、排序技巧

1. 多级排序

在Excel中,我们可以对数据进行多级排序,即先按照某一列排序,如果相同,则按照下一列排序。例如,我们有一张学生成绩表,需要先按照总分降序排序,总分相同的情况下,再按照语文成绩升序排序。操作步骤如下:

(1)选中需要排序的数据区域。

(2)点击“数据”选项卡,在“排序和筛选”组中,点击“排序”。

(3)在“主要关键字”下拉列表中选择“总分”,点击“降序”。

(4)点击“添加条件”,在“次要关键字”下拉列表中选择“语文”,点击“升序”。

(5)点击“确定”,即可完成多级排序。

2. 按条件排序

在Excel中,我们可以根据特定条件对数据进行排序。例如,我们需要将成绩表中的不及格学生筛选出来,并按照成绩从低到高排序。操作步骤如下:

(1)选中需要排序的数据区域。

(2)点击“数据”选项卡,在“排序和筛选”组中,点击“排序”。

(3)在“主要关键字”下拉列表中选择“成绩”,点击“自定义排序”。

(4)在“排序依据”下拉列表中选择“数字”,在“排序方式”下拉列表中选择“小于”,在“排序包含”下拉列表中选择“单元格内容”。

(5)在“排序包含”下的文本框中输入“60”,点击“确定”。

(6)点击“确定”,即可完成按条件排序。

3. 使用公式排序

在Excel中,我们还可以使用公式进行排序。以下是一个示例:

假设我们有一张学生成绩表,需要根据学生的年龄进行排序。我们可以使用以下公式:

```excel

=IF(A2"", A2, 1)

```

其中,A2是年龄所在的单元格。这个公式的作用是将年龄不为空的单元格按照年龄排序,年龄为空的单元格排在最后。

4. 使用透视表排序

透视表是一种强大的数据分析工具,我们可以通过透视表对数据进行排序。以下是一个示例:

(1)选中需要排序的数据区域。

(2)点击“插入”选项卡,在“表格”组中,点击“透视表”。

(3)在弹出的“创建透视表”对话框中,选择数据源区域,点击“确定”。

(4)在透视表字段列表中,将“年龄”字段拖到“行”区域。

(5)在“排序”选项卡中,设置排序依据和排序方式。

(6)点击“确定”,即可完成透视表排序。

三、相关问答

1. 问:如何撤销排序操作?

答: 在Excel中,您可以通过以下方式撤销排序操作:

使用快捷键Ctrl + Z撤销上一步操作。

点击“数据”选项卡,在“排序和筛选”组中,点击“排序”,然后选择“取消排序”。

2. 问:如何对非文本数据进行排序?

答: 在Excel中,您可以对非文本数据进行排序,只需在“排序”对话框中,将“排序依据”设置为“数值”即可。

3. 问:如何对日期数据进行排序?

答: 在Excel中,您可以将日期数据作为文本或数值进行排序。如果将日期数据作为文本排序,请确保日期格式正确;如果作为数值排序,请将日期转换为数值格式。

4. 问:如何对包含空单元格的数据进行排序?

答: 在Excel中,您可以通过在“排序”对话框中设置“排序包含”为“空值”,来对包含空单元格的数据进行排序。